کارت گرافیک مورد نیاز برای برنامه نویسی کدام است؟

آیا شما هم یک برنامه‌نویس هستید و قصد دارید سیستم جدیدی برای کارتان اسمبل کنید؟ به نظر شما وجود یک کارت گرافیک در برنامه‌نویسی مهم است؟ بسیاری از کاربران هنگام اسمبل کردن سیستم جدید، بیشترین تمرکزشان روی کارت گرافیک است، اما آیا واقعاً یک سیستم برنامه‌نویسی نیاز به خرید کارت گرافیک مجزا دارد؟ حقیقت این است که تأثیر این قطعه در برنامه‌نویسی بستگی مستقیم به حوزه کاری شما دارد. اگر شما فقط توسعه نرم‌افزار یا طراحی وب انجام می‌دهید، حتی یک گرافیک یکپارچه هم کفایت می‌کند. اما اگر وارد دنیای یادگیری ماشین، هوش مصنوعی یا بازی‌سازی سه‌بعدی شوید، ماجرا کاملاً متفاوت خواهد بود.

آنچه در این مقاله خواهید خواند:

  • راهنمای خرید کارت گرافیک مناسب برای برنامه نویسی
  • معرفی 5 کارت گرافیک خوب برای برنامه نویسی

راهنمای خرید کارت گرافیک مناسب برای برنامه نویسی

معمولاً برای برنامه نویسی، نیاز به کارت گرافیک قدرتمند به اندازه سایر زمینه‌ها مانند بازی‌سازی یا طراحی سه‌بعدی نیست. در بیشتر مواقع در برنامه نویسی، گرافیک‌های یکپارچه که در پردازنده‌های نسل جدید Intel و AMD تعبیه شده‌اند، کافی خواهد بود. این پردازنده‌ها نسبت به نسل‌های گذشته خود، توانایی بالاتری در پردازش گرافیکی دارند. بنابراین معمولاً وجود کارت گرافیک برای برنامه نویسی ضروری نیست.

چرا گرافیک یکپارچه برای برنامه نویسی کافی است؟

تنها دلیلی که ممکن است شما به عنوان یک برنامه نویس به خرید کارت گرافیک مجزا فکر کنید، قدرت کمتر گرافیک یکپارچه است. این یعنی اگر برنامه‌نویسی شما بیشتر شامل پروژه‌های معمولی مثل توسعه وب، اپلیکیشن موبایل یا نرم‌افزارهای سبک باشد، نیازی به کارت گرافیک قوی ندارید. در این حالت پردازنده و رم، قطعاتی هستند که اهمیت بیشتری پیدا می‌کنند. بنابراین برای برنامه‌نویسی گرافیک یکپارچه به دلایل زیر کافی است:

هزینه کمتر: شما نیازی به کارت گرافیک جداگانه ندارید، چون گرافیک پردازنده برایتان کافی خواهد بود.
مصرف انرژی پایین: گرافیک یکپارچه برق کمتری مصرف می‌کند. (کارت گرافیک یکپارچه چیست؟)
تولید حرارت کمتر: گرافیک یکپارچه نسبت به کارت گرافیک اختصاصی، گرمای کمتری تولید خواهد کرد.

پیشنهاد مطالعه: سازگاری کارت گرافیک با سی پی یو

اهمیت کارت گرافیک قوی برای برنامه‌نویسی

برخی زمینه‌های برنامه نویسی یا فعالیت‌های مرتبط به گرافیک یا پردازش سنگین، به GPU قوی نیاز دارند اما این زمینه‌ها چه هستند؟

  • توسعه بازی و برنامه‌های گرافیکی: موتورهای بازی‌سازی مانند Unity و Unreal Engine برای رندر روان و پردازش تصاویر سه‌بعدی، نیاز به کارت‌های گرافیک قدرتمند خواهند داشت.
  • هوش مصنوعی و یادگیری ماشین: پردازش‌های موازی روی کارت گرافیک، با استفاده از فناوری‌هایی مثل CUDA و Tensor Cores در کارت‌های NVIDIA، باعث افزایش سرعت انجام محاسبات می‌شود.(بهترین کارت گرافیک برای هوش مصنوعی)
  • شبیه‌سازی و طراحی سه‌بعدی: نرم‌افزارهایی مانند Blender، AutoCAD و MATLAB با کارت گرافیک مناسب، رندر سریع‌تر و پردازش بهتر داده‌های حجیم را ممکن می‌کنند.

معرفی 5 کارت گرافیک خوب برای برنامه نویسی

همان‌طور که ذکر شد، نیاز به کارت گرافیک بستگی به حوزه کاری شما دارد. برای کارهای سبک گرافیک یکپارچه کافی است. اما در کارهای گرافیکی سنگین، انتخاب کارت گرافیک مخصوص برنامه نویسی اهمیت بالایی دارد.

کارت گرافیک ام اس آی MSI GeForce RTX 4090 SUPRIM 24G

کارت گرافیک ام اس آی MSI GeForce RTX 4090 SUPRIM 24G با پردازنده قدرتمند و فرکانس پایه 2230 مگاهرتز، دارای 24 گیگابایت حافظه GDDR6X با رابط 384 بیت بوده و قابلیت اورکلاک نیز دارد. این محصول بهترین کارت گرافیک برای برنامه نویسی است که با ابعاد 336×142×78 میلی‌متر تولید می‌شود و برای نصب به سه اسلات نیاز دارد.

این کارت گرافیک ام اس آی دارای سه فن و سیستم خنک‌کننده هیت سینک است و مصرف برق آن حدود 480 وات است، بنابراین منبع تغذیه پیشنهادی حداقل 850 تا 1000 وات است. این کارت از DirectX 12 Ultimate و OpenGL 4.6 پشتیبانی می‌کند و قابلیت اتصال همزمان چهار مانیتور از طریق پورت‌های HDMI و DisplayPort را دارد و بهترین کارت گرافیک برای گیمینگ و تولید محتوای چندرسانه‌ای با رزولوشن 7680×4320 می باشد.

کارت گرافیک ایسوس ROG Strix GeForce RTX 4080 16GB GDDR6X

این محصول دارای پردازنده قدرتمند با فرکانس پایه 2505 مگاهرتز و قابلیت اورکلاک تا 2535 مگاهرتز برای اجرای بازی‌ها، کارهای سنگین برنامه‌نویسی و اجرای نرم‌افزارهای گرافیکی سنگین بسیار مناسب است. کارت گرافیک ایسوس ROG Strix GeForce RTX 4080 16GB GDDR6X با رابط 256 بیت بهره می‌برد و از سیستم خنک‌کننده شامل هیت‌سینک، پایپ و سه فن استفاده می‌کند تا حرارت به‌خوبی کنترل شود. رزولوشن خروجی این محصول تا 7680×4320 پیکسل می‌رسد. توان مصرفی پایه این کار گرافیک ایسوس 320 وات است.

کارت گرافیک زوتاک GAMING GeForce RTX 4080 16GB AMP Extreme AIRO

این کارت گرافیک با پردازنده قدرتمند و فرکانس افزایشی 2565 مگاهرتز، دارای 16 گیگابایت حافظه GDDR6X با رابط 256 بیت بوده و از DirectX 12 Ultimate و OpenGL 4.6 پشتیبانی می‌کند. کارت گرافیک زوتاک با ابعاد 355.5×149.6×72.1 میلی‌متر ساخته می‌شود و نیاز به چهار اسلات نصب، کارت مجهز به سیستم خنک‌کننده با سه فن دارد.

کارت گرافیک زوتاک GAMING GeForce RTX 4080 16GB AMP Extreme AIRO امکان اتصال هم‌زمان چهار مانیتور از طریق پورت‌های HDMI و DisplayPort را فراهم می‌کند و رزولوشن خروجی آن تا 7680×4320 پیکسل می‌رسد. مصرف برق کارت حدود 320 وات است و برای عملکرد بهینه حداقل منبع تغذیه پیشنهادی 750 وات در نظر گرفته شده است.

پیشنهاد مطالعه: کارت گرافیک مناسب رندرینگ کدام است؟

کارت گرافیک مدل AORUS GeForce RTX 4080 16GB MASTER گیگابایت

کارت گرافیک گیگابایت مجهز به پردازنده RTX 4080 با معماری Ada Lovelace، فرکانس پایه 2210 مگاهرتز و فرکانس بوست 2550 مگاهرتز، عملکرد فوق‌العاده‌ای به گیمرها و برنامه‌نویسان ارائه می‌دهد. کارت گرافیک مدل AORUS GeForce RTX 4080 16GB MASTER دارای 16 گیگابایت حافظه GDDR6X با باس 256 بیت، سه فن برای خنک‌کنندگی مؤثر و پشتیبانی از نورپردازی RGB است.

این کارت با رابط PCI-E 4.0، یک پورت HDMI 2.1 و سه پورت DisplayPort 1.4a امکان اتصال هم‌زمان چهار مانیتور را فراهم کرده و رزولوشن خروجی آن تا 7680×4320 پیکسل می‌رسد. مصرف برق کارت 320 وات است و حداقل منبع تغذیه پیشنهادی برای عملکرد بهینه 850 وات در نظر گرفته شده است.

کارت گرافیک ام اس ای مدل MSI GeForce RTX 4080 GAMING X TRIO 16G GDDR6X

این کارت گرافیک با پردازنده‌ای قدرتمند و فرکانس 2595 مگاهرتز تولید می‌شود. این محصول دارای 16 گیگابایت حافظه GDDR6X با رابط 256 بیت و قابلیت اورکلاک است و از طریق رابط PCI Express 4.0 به سیستم متصل می‌شود. کارت گرافیک MSI GeForce RTX 4080 GAMING X TRIO 16G GDDR6X مجهز به سیستم خنک‌کننده هیت‌سینک، پایپ و سه فن است و برای نصب به سه اسلات نیاز دارد. این محصول با پشتیبانی از DirectX 12 و OpenGL 4.6، امکان اتصال هم‌زمان چهار مانیتور را از طریق پورت‌های HDMI و DisplayPort فراهم می‌کند. رزولوشن خروجی آن تا 7680×4320 پیکسل می‌رسد.

جدول مقایسه کارت‌های گرافیک مناسب برنامه‌نویسی

مدل کارت گرافیک

حافظه

فرکانس پایه

توان مصرفی پایه

MSI RTX 4090 SUPRIM 24G

24GB GDDR6X

2230 MHz

480W

ASUS ROG Strix RTX 4080 16GB

16GB GDDR6X

2505 MHz

320W

ZOTAC RTX 4080 AMP Extreme AIRO

16GB GDDR6X

2565 MHz

320W

AORUS RTX 4080 MASTER

16GB GDDR6X

2210 MHz

320W

MSI RTX 4080 GAMING X TRIO

16GB GDDR6X

2595 MHz

320W

نتیجه‌گیری

انتخاب یک کارت گرافیک خوب برای برنامه‌نویسی به حوزه کاری شما بستگی دارد؛ اگر در زمینه یادگیری ماشین، هوش مصنوعی، توسعه بازی یا نرم‌افزارهای گرافیکی سنگین فعالیت می‌کنید، یک کارت گرافیک قدرتمند تفاوت قابل توجهی در سرعت و کیفیت کارتان ایجاد می‌کند.
فروشگاه اینترنتی بروزکالا با ارائه کارت‌های گرافیک با برندهای معتبر، گارانتی بلندمدت و امکان خرید اقساطی، فرصت خرید تجهیزات حرفه‌ای را با قیمت مناسب برای شما فراهم کرده است.

سوالات متداول

1. آیا وجود کارت گرافیک برای برنامه نویسی ضروری است؟
خیر کارت گرافیک عموماً برای برنامه نویسی ضروری نیست و بسیاری از برنامه نویسان می‌توانند با کارت گرافیک یکپارچه که در CPU وجود دارد، کار کنند. اما اگر برنامه‌نویسی روی نرم‌افزارهای گرافیکی، بازی‌سازی یا کارهای محاسباتی سنگین مانند یادگیری ماشین انجام می‌دهید، کارت گرافیک قدرتمندتر نیاز خواهد شد.
2. بهترین نوع کارت گرافیکی برای برنامه نویسی کدام است؟
برای برنامه نویسی معمولی کارت گرافیک یکپارچه کافی است. اما اگر به کارت گرافیک نیاز دارید، کارت‌های NVIDIA از سری GTX به دلیل قیمت مناسب و عملکرد خوب گزینه خوبی هستند.
3. تفاوت کارت گرافیک یکپارچه و اختصاصی چیست و کدام بهتر است؟
کارت گرافیک یکپارچه در CPU تعبیه شده و مصرف انرژی کمتری دارد و هزینه جداگانه نیاز ندارد. اما کارت گرافیک اختصاصی عملکرد بهتر و قدرتمندتری ارائه می‌دهد و برای پردازش‌های گرافیکی سنگین‌تر مناسب‌تر است.